The Rich History of St Peter's Church Leuven

St Peter's Church boasts a fascinating past. Construction began in the 15th century. It replaced an earlier Romanesque church on the same site. The church suffered damage over centuries.

Fires, wars, and renovations shaped its current form. It stands as a testament to resilience. Architects like Sulpitius van Vorst contributed to its design. The Brabantine Gothic style is clearly evident.

Architectural Marvels and Design Elements

St Peter's Church showcases stunning Gothic architecture. It features soaring arches and intricate stonework. The Brabantine Gothic style is distinctive. This style uses local sandstone and brick.

Notice the impressive tower base. Unfortunately, the planned spires were never completed. This adds a unique character to the building. The exterior details are worth a close look.

Experiencing Dirk Bouts' 'The Last Supper'

The masterpiece, 'The Last Supper', resides here. It was painted by Dirk Bouts in the 15th century. This Flemish Primitive work is internationally renowned. It draws art lovers from around the globe.

Bouts' painting is truly revolutionary. It shows Christ and his apostles at the table. The use of perspective was groundbreaking. Observe the detailed expressions and gestures. This work is a highlight of your visit.

Planning Your 2025 Visit: Tickets & Opening Hours

Visiting St Peter's Church Leuven is straightforward. The church is centrally located in the Grote Markt. It sits opposite the historic Town Hall. Getting around Leuven is easy, often by foot.

Admission fees apply to the art treasury. This is where 'The Last Supper' is displayed. Expect ticket prices around €5-€7 for adults. Discounts are available for students and seniors. Check the official website for 2025 pricing updates.

Opening hours vary by season. Typically, the church is open Tuesday to Sunday. Hours are usually from 10:00 AM to 5:00 PM. Mondays are often closed for visitors. Always confirm times on the church's official site. They may change for special events or holidays.

Beyond 'The Last Supper': Other Treasures to Discover

While Dirk Bouts' masterpiece is a highlight, other treasures await. The church houses many significant artworks. Look for the impressive 15th-century tabernacle. It stands over 12 meters tall.

Several side altars feature notable paintings. You will find sculptures and intricate woodcarvings. The pulpit is also a finely crafted piece. Take time to explore each chapel carefully.

Don't miss the crypt beneath the church. It contains remnants of the earlier Romanesque building. This offers a glimpse into Leuven's deep past. Access to the crypt may require a guide. Check availability upon arrival for 2025.

The church also holds various religious artifacts. Precious vestments and reliquaries are displayed. These items offer cultural and historical insights.
